Error Messages and Troubleshooting
The table below provides basic information on the errors generated
by the Model 3775 CPC, and suggestions for corrective action.
When an error occurs, the status bar at the top of the screen turns
red and the error is displayed e.g., “Saturator temp out of range.”
When multiple errors are present “Multiple Errors” is indicated. To
help determine the type of errors, refer to the Status Screen (see
Figure 4-9). The number presented in the right column appears red
if out of range. Refer to
Table 8-3 to help identify the problem.
When the pump is turned off in User Settings (
Figure 4-5), the error
bar turns yellow and “Pump off” is indicated.
When called upon to remove the cover for service in the
troubleshooting table, follow instructions below:
1. Read warnings and cautions at the beginning of this chapter.
2. Unplug the instrument and remove the instrument cover by
loosening the six side panel screws (they don’t have to be fully
removed). Lift the cover up. Do not remove the screws holding
the clear butanol reservoir cover.
Table 8-3
Troubleshooting
Problem Description Problems/Suggestions
Status:
Concentration out of
range
Concentration exceeds the
specification of 10
7
particles/cm
3
.
Concentration entering the CPC is too high.
Dilute the aerosol before it enters the CPC
Status: Saturator
temp out of range
Saturator temperature out of
range ~±0.5 degree C.
Warm up is not complete, instrument is operating in
an environment outside its specified operating range
(10 to 35
°C), or instrument was removed recently
from a temperature extreme.
Place instrument in an appropriate environment,
allow temperature to stablize.
Status: Condenser
temp out of range
Condenser temperature out of
range ~±0.5 degree C.
Warm up is not complete, instrument is operating in
an environment outside its specified operating range
(10 to 35
°C), instrument was removed recently from
a temperature extreme, or fan flow is impaired.
Place instrument in an appropriate environment,
allow temperature to stablize. Clean or replace fan
filter, remove object blocking fan flow.
Status: Optics temp
out of range
Optics temperature out of
range ±2 degrees C.
Warm up is not complete, instrument is operating in
an environment outside its specified operating range
(10 to 35
°C), or instrument was removed recently
from a temperature extreme.
Place instrument in an appropriate environment,
allow temperature to stabilize.
